What are the most common types of immigration cases handled by attorneys in Greenlawn, NY?

In Greenlawn and the surrounding Suffolk County area, immigration attorneys frequently handle family-based petitions, adjustment of status, naturalization (citizenship) applications, and deportation defense. Given the local demographics, there is also significant work with employment-based visas for professionals working in nearby tech corridors and healthcare, as well as assistance for individuals with Temporary Protected Status (TPS). Attorneys here are well-versed in navigating the specific procedural requirements of the USCIS New York Field Office and the immigration courts in New York City that have jurisdiction over Long Island residents.

How can a Greenlawn, NY immigration attorney help me if I'm facing removal proceedings?

A Greenlawn-based immigration attorney can provide critical representation before the New York Immigration Court. They will analyze your case for potential relief, such as cancellation of removal, asylum, or adjustment of status, and develop a strong defense strategy. They are familiar with the practices of local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) offices and can advocate for you in bond hearings, often arguing for release based on your community ties to Suffolk County. Their local knowledge is key in connecting you with necessary resources and expert witnesses in the area to support your case.

What should I look for when choosing an immigration lawyer in Greenlawn, NY?

When selecting an immigration attorney in Greenlawn, prioritize those who are members of the American Immigration Lawyers Association (AILA) and have specific experience with the New York USCIS Field Office and the relevant immigration courts. Look for a lawyer who is accessible for in-person consultations in Suffolk County and understands the local community's unique challenges. It's also crucial to verify their track record with cases similar to yours, whether it's family-based petitions common in the area or complex employment-based matters for the local workforce. Always check their standing with the New York State Bar Association.

A qualified citizenship lawyer in the Greenlawn vicinity does much more than just fill out Form N-400. They provide comprehensive guidance tailored to your unique situation. This begins with a thorough review of your eligibility, ensuring you meet all the continuous residence and physical presence requirements. They can help you gather and prepare the necessary supporting documents, which often involves obtaining records from your home country or from various U.S. agencies. Perhaps most importantly, they will prepare you meticulously for your naturalization interview and the civics and English tests administered at the USCIS field office, which for many Greenlawn residents is the Holtsville office. A local attorney is familiar with the officers and the common questions asked there, allowing for targeted preparation.

When looking for an immigration attorney near Greenlawn, it's essential to verify their credentials and experience. Seek out a lawyer who is a member of the American Immigration Lawyers Association (AILA), as this indicates a dedicated practice in immigration law. Schedule initial consultations, which are often offered at a low cost or even free, to discuss your case. Use this meeting to ask about their experience with citizenship cases specifically, their familiarity with the Long Island immigration landscape, and their communication style. Be wary of anyone who guarantees results or asks for large fees upfront without a clear service agreement.
